Welcome to ECF eddy-r3 and congrats. In regards to vapor:
PG= TH, Lung Hit and flavor enhancer
VG= vapor
Nicotine= TH, Lung Hit and our need for nicotine
Most juices are 70/ 30 or 80/ 20 PG/ VG
so if it's more vapor you're looking for you could possibly adjust these ratios or ask the vendor for a specific ratio when ordering juices. Realize VG is thick so a heavy VG mix will clog attys, cart and cartos faster.

The PG and the nicotine have a diuretic effect, yes. Lots of water.

...yes PG/VG are humectants and absorb water from your soft tissue/mucus membranes to make all that glorious vapor so, drink lotssa water, as it not only helps the dry throat but helps flush/detox all those other chemicals BP adds to the funkarettes.............

Although ecigs have not been around long enough for long term studies, they are generally considered very safe. PG and VG are used in lots of things used daily. PG is also used in hospitals as an anti-bacterial in the air flow systems. They are also used in medicinal vaporizers, and in fog machines for drama productions. Really they are all around you every day.
